Publication number: 20190090966Abstract: A robotic system and methods for performing spine surgery are disclosed. The system comprises a robotic manipulator with a tool to hold a screw and to rotate the screw about a rotational axis. The screw is self-tapping and has a known thread geometry that is stored by a controller. A navigation system tracks a position of a target site. Movement of the robotic manipulator is controlled to maintain the rotational axis of the surgical tool along a planned trajectory with respect to the target site based on the tracked position of the target site. In autonomous or manual modes of operation, the rotational rate of the screw about the rotational axis and/or an advancement rate of the screw linearly along the planned trajectory is controlled to be proportional to the known thread geometry stored in the memory.Type: ApplicationFiled: November 8, 2018Publication date: March 28, 2019Applicant: MAKO Surgical Corp.Inventors: Hyosig Kang, Jienan Ding, David Gene Bowling, Christopher Wayne Jones, Greg McEwan, Lucas Gsellman

Patent number: 8158201Abstract: A bi- or multi-layer coating is deposited upon a substrate using a low temperature process. The bi-layer is a lower layer of a SAM coating, which is overlaid with a hard coating. The hard coating can be made of materials such as: polymer, Si3N4, BN, TiN, Si02, Al203, Zr02, YSZ, and other ceramic materials, and the underlying, compliant, SAM coating can comprise substances containing long chain molecules that chemically bond to the substrate. This bi-layer provides both environmental and hermetical protection to electronic hardware and MEMS systems, without employing expensive packaging materials and processes. Multiple bi-layers may be combined to form multi-layer coatings. A protective polymer or other material may optionally be formed as an outside layer.Type: GrantFiled: March 5, 2007Date of Patent: April 17, 2012Assignee: The Research Foundation of StateInventors: Junghyun Cho, Scott Oliver, Wayne Jones, Bahgat Sammakia
